Abstract
In this paper the results of temperature measurements made on refrigerated trailers are given. The purpose of the experiments was to investigate the temperature pull down and distribution inside refrigerated trailers just after loading with previously uncooled perishables. The number of measurement locations can be reduced considerably if the purpose is to get an idea about uniformity only. To obtain details of the ventilating system and reduce random errors, approximately 30 measurement locations may be sufficient.
